Detroit, US-based charity fundraising platform CrowdRise bagged $23 million in a funding round with Union Square Ventures as the lead investor to back its growth campaigns and platform expansion initiatives.

After saying no to an informal acquisition bid worth $100 million from AOL last year, Business Insider is likely set to raise new funds from its existing backers, re/code reported.
